About the role:
PIMHS is a specialist perinatal Mental Health service for parents (and their infants) with a severe, acute, or complex mental illness, or are at imminent risk of relapse/episode and who are pregnant or have a child under the age of two. PIMHS provides time limited, intensive specialist Perinatal and Infant Mental Health support, either provided through direct patient care or consultation for a range of severe or complex perinatal Mental Health disorders including severe depression and/or anxiety, postpartum psychosis, bipolar affective disorder, schizophrenia, complex trauma and personality disorders. PIMHS works alongside the allocated Mental Health Clinician and collaboratively with adult and Infant/child health services to support care for both parent and Infant. PIMHS has a key role in establishing key care pathways and referrals to ongoing providers in the community.

Alongside the multi-disciplinary clinical supports of the Mehi Adult Mental Health Team including direct line management, you will also be supported by broader PIMHS HNE Team including a Perinatal Consultant Psychiatrist, CAMHS Special Program Coordinator and 6 other PIMHS Clinicians (via weekly PIMHS team meetings + supervision via telehealth). The position has professional responsibility to the appropriate HNELHD Mental Health Head of Discipline and will be linked into discipline specific supervision and supports. You will also have the opportunity to be linked to the Statewide PIMHS clinicians – through the annual PIMHS Conference (Nov), and supported locally to engage in education opportunities specific to your role.
